Title: GOOD GRADES/READING REWARDS Post by: SavvyShopper on June 20, 2006, 09:58:11 AM Chuck E Cheese - FREE tokens for good grades (3 for an A, 2 for a B, etc, up to a total of 15 per kid).
Krispy Kreme Doughnuts - FREE doughnuts 1 per A Up to 6 FREE Blockbuster - 1 FREE "Kids/Families" movie rental for "A's" on your report card. Fazoli's - Fazoli's doesn't have rewards for grades. However, young readers can ask their local Fazoli's about the Friendly Reader Program. You can get a Fazoli's bookmark and fill out the information on the bookmark. Then read 5 books, and you will receive a free kid's meal. NOTE: Not all Fazoli's Restaurants participate in this program, so check with the Fazoli's nearest you for details. Limited Too - $5 discount on merchandise for a report card with passing grades on it. Albertson's - 2 FREE Movie rentals for good grades (Not sure if they are still doing this or not!) (my girls thank you, too :) ) Title: Re: GOOD GRADES/READING REWARDS Post by: SavvyShopper on May 09, 2008, 10:14:26 AM Barnes & Noble has started their FREE BOOK for Summer Reading program again. We do this with our daughter each year and she loves it!
http://www.barnesandnoble.com/summerreading/index.asp?r=1&afsrc=1&r=1 Here's How It Works: 1. Kids read any 8 books. 2. Kids use the Summer Reading Journal to tell us their favorite part of each book. A parent/guardian signs it when it's complete. 3. Children bring their completed journal to a Barnes & Noble store between May 29th & September 2nd, 2008. 4. We'll give them a coupon for a FREE book! They choose from a list of exceptional paperback titles.* * Eligible books will be listed on the coupon. Choices must be made from eligible stock. No special orders. Limit of 1 form per school-age child (grades 1-6), please. Incomplete forms will be ineligible for free books.
